Hi, I’m Jennifer. I teach individuals and practitioners about holistic healing to facilitate their own healing paths and support their work with patients.
As a Medical Physician,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or, Writer and Teacher my focus is on teaching the art of science of healing.
As a Board Certified Obstetrician and Gynecologist, I spent nearly two decades devoted to Women’s Health. During that time, I embarked upon my own spiritual path which led me to learn all about different healing modalities, including Indiginous practices, Eastern medicine practices and Energy Healing frameworks. To fully realize the holistic healing framework that was emerging from my studies, I pivoted to the field of mental health and got my Masters of Arts in Counseling degree at Northwestern University and then became a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or.
As a licensed Physician and Mental Health Counselor with a background in spiritual study and practice, I have had the privilege of teaching mental health practitioners, physicians, nurses, and other healers about various aspects of healing. My unique background allowed me to also serve as a Clinical Lecturer of Psychopharmacology in the Master of Arts in Counseling Program at Northwestern University and as a Clinical Supervisor at Skylight Counseling Center. Additionally, I have offered workshops for continuing education credits for therapists on the subjects of Menopause & Mental Health and Breaking Patterns to foster healing.
